Walt Disney
Disney is a name synonymous with many emotions. We can’t imagine the amount of effort put into the studio’s movies, games, and TV shows. The franchise is ubiquitous, and the foundation of its success is laid by the classic animated films that have brought the studio to life.
Walt Disney Animation Studios was founded in 1923. The two brothers were initially responsible for producing animated short films. Over the years, we’ve seen characters like Mickey Mouse and Donald Duck brought to life. Snow White and the Seven Dwarfs is the studio’s most popular film, and if you factor in movie ticket price inflation, it would be one of the most profitable animated films ever made.
Studio Ghibli

Studio Ghibli is arguably the most beloved animation studio in the world, and it’s all thanks to Hayao Miyazaki and the insanely talented team of animators that are part of the company. The amount of detail and heartfelt emotion that goes into each of Ghibli’s films is astounding.
The first film Nausicaä of the Valley of the Wind released in 1984 was quite successful and it allowed Studio Ghibli to become the organization it is today. Not once has the studio faltered when it came to delivering top-notch storytelling and animation. If that doesn’t impress you, eight of the fifteen highest-grossing animated films of all time are owned by Studio Ghibli.
Dreamworks
Dreamworks Animation has always lived in the shadow of giants like Pixar and Disney, but no matter how you look at it, the studio is still one of the best animation studios. From theater to television, the studio has yet to fail to deliver compelling stories that are beautifully choreographed.
After all, the studio was co-founded by the great Steven Spielberg and alongside Jeffrey Katzenberg and David Geffen. With some of the best animators working at the studio, we’ve experienced some of the best franchises over the years with Shrek and Kung Fu Panda as two of their most notable films. While other studios may have an edge over Dreamworks, the studio will be considered one of the greats over time.

Toei Animation
If you are familiar with anime, then you must have heard of Toei Animation with Dragon Ball being their most famous franchise. Other popular series include Sailor Moon, Yu-Gi-Oh! and One Piece. Although Toei’s fan base is mainly from Japan, anime is becoming more popular globally. With several popular franchises in the works, we don’t expect the studio to slow down anytime soon.

Oriental Light and Magic
Oriental Light and Magic has undergone a rapid transition over the years, and it has rebranded itself as just OLM. It is one of the few Japanese studios to be successful in the United States as well as other countries.
While you may not have heard of most of the titles that OLM has produced over the years, one name has resonated through generations of people, and that is Pokemon. The animated series is still running successfully and it is, in fact, the most valuable franchise in the world. And we’re not talking about cartoons; we’re talking about any entertainment franchise including the Marvel Cinematic Universe!
